Output 123232e560578e62d6053e40375701cdeb0a2e660a3f041a75f51ada8f355114:0

value
884450000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4690e7b2398ca117f50b4cd4c0f015c150ad0979 OP_EQUALVERIFY OP_CHECKSIG
address
17S7tcHm8FgTwGQ68JQMuwyy5gd9XVbSCo
transaction
123232e560578e62d6053e40375701cdeb0a2e660a3f041a75f51ada8f355114
spent
true